    Subject: Rotax 447 rubber carb socket
    Hi all, I am trying to find the source of a better quality rubber carb socket for my Rotax 447. Previously I've seen this remarked about on the list and I think it was a company named JDM. But I haven't found it in the archives nor on ebay, which is where it was supposedly advertised. Can anyone help? Bill Varnes Original Kolb FireStar Audubon NJ Do Not Archive

    Subject: Rotax 447 rubber carb socket
    I am trying to find the source of a better quality rubber carb socket for my Rotax 447. Previously I've seen this remarked about on the list and I think it was a company named JDM. But I haven't found it in the archives nor on ebay, which is where it was supposedly advertised. Can anyone help? Bill Varnes Bill/Folks: Try this one: http://jbmindustries.com/ I bought their SS springs for my Titan Exhaust System. They were expensive, but they are much, much better quality than the standard spring. john h mkIII Rock House, Oregon
